Function and role of the âSpray Coating in Appliance Finishâ integrity and Corrosion Protection
350930 Whirlpool White Spray⢠Paint serves primarily as a⤠restorative and protective organic coating for appliance exterior panels, providing a â˘continuous film that limits direct contact between the metal substrate and corrosive agents such as water, saltsand⣠cleaning chemicals. The âcoating’s effectivenessâ depends on binder chemistry,pigment â˘load,and the achieved dry-film thickness; when applied over a compatible primer and properly⢠prepared surface (degreased,derusted,and lightly abraded),the spray paint develops adhesion and mechanical integrity similar âto that of a touch-up finish. In practice,â this product⣠is used to repair chips, cover abrasionsand refresh visual uniformity on refrigerators, dishwashersand range hoods, but it does not restore OEM factory multilayer systems â¤unless the same âprimer and curing conditions are duplicated.
- Surface preparation:â clean, remove loose corrosion, apply compatible⣠primer âif bare metal is exposed.
- Application practice: light, multiple passes to reachâ target dry-filmâ thickness; allow solvent flash and full cure before heavy use.
- Compatibility â¤checks: test adhesion and color match â˘on a small area when overcoating existing finishes orâ different metals.
As a corrosion-control element âthe coating⢠provides a physical barrier and some chemical resistance; âŁit reduces the rate of corrosion by limiting oxygen and moisture diffusion to the substrate but does not provide cathodic protection. Long-term performance depends on film continuity, edge sealing at seamsand resistance⢠to abrasion from handling and cleaning agents. â¤For technicians, measuring dry-film thickness, confirming cure (tack-free and solvent resistance), â¤and inspecting edges and fastener interfaces are practical measures to verify performance after application. When repairingâ heavily pitted or undercut rust, mechanical removal âand metal treatment are required before repainting to⤠avoid â˘premature failure of the coating.

Howâ the 350930 whirlpool White Spray Paint Bonds, Curesand Performs Under Operational Conditions
The 350930 Whirlpool White⢠Spray Paint bonds to appliance substrates by a combination of mechanical interlock and resin adhesion. Proper⤠bonding depends primarily on surface energy and cleanliness: factory-painted or powder-coated panels typically accept the âspray paint well after light abrasion to remove glossâ and a solvent wipe to eliminate oils⤠and âparticulates. Bare steel or aluminum requires a compatible primerâ to promote chemical adhesion and âcorrosion resistance; without primer the paint will rely mostly âon mechanical grip and will have reduced long-term durability. During âapplication the solvent⣠carrier allows the â˘polymer to flow and wet the substrate; initial tack-free set results âfrom solvent evaporation, while intercoat adhesion relies on applying subsequent coats within the recommended recoat window or lightly abrading if that window is⢠missed.
Under operational conditions the cured film performs as a thin, protectiveâ enamel intended for exterior appliance surfaces, exhibiting moderate resistance to household detergents, condensationand routine mechanical abrasion from âŁhandling⢠and use.â Thermalâ cycling âŁfrom normal appliance operation (ambient to moderate elevated surface temperatures) can⤠cause differential expansion of âŁsubstrate âŁand coating; adhesion systems that â¤include a primer and⤠correct film thickness â¤(typically built up in multiple lightâ passes) reduce â¤risk of edge lifting⤠or cracking. For practical maintenance,treatâ panels exposed to repeated mechanical âcontact (hinges,edges) with âŁadditional localâ coats or primer,avoid use on⤠continuously high-heat components,and allow theâ coating to reach full cure (see table) before subjecting the part to heavy⣠use or cleaning chemicals.
- Key factors affectingâ performance: substrate preparation, primer compatibility, ambient temperature/humidity during applicationand final â˘dry-film thickness.

Common Failure Symptoms and Degradation Modes of the White Spray Finish
The 350930 Whirlpool White spray Paint is used as a thin protective and aesthetic â˘coating for appliance exterior panels and touch-up repairs; it is formulated to adhere to primed metal,â baked enamel,⤠and some powder-coated substrates when âappropriate surface preparation and⤠curing parameters are followed. In service the coating functions â¤as an opaque barrier against moisture, mild detergentsand everyday abrasion, while also providing a consistent color match âfor cosmetic repairs. Performance depends on film thickness, âsubstrateâ cleanlinessand âcure time-insufficient surface abrasion or solvent â¤residue before applicationor improper drying conditions, will reduce adhesion and accelerate degradation.
Failure modes of this spray finish are primarily mechanical, chemicalandâ thermal in origin andâ produce distinctive symptoms that help identify root âcauses.â Common degradation includes loss of gloss and color fade from UV and oxidative exposure, chalking from polymer breakdown, cracking or âcrazing from thermal cycling and substrate flexand localized peeling â¤orâ blistering where moisture or corrosive cleaners⣠penetrated the interface. Practical examples: âŁpaint lifting along door âseams where âflex is concentrated, accelerated abrasion on handle edges from repeated contactand blistering near heating elements or⤠steam paths⤠whereâ elevated temperatures and trapped moisture compromise the âbond.
- Loss of⢠gloss: Uniform dulling due to surface oxidation or minute âerosion of the binder matrix.
- Chalking: Powdery surface â¤residue from polymer degradation,frequently enough first seen on horizontal surfaces.
- Cracking/crazing: âŁFine lines indicating brittle film or substrate movement exceeding the film’s elongation.
- Peeling/flaking: Adhesion â¤failure usually at edges or poorly prepared areas, often tied to contamination or rust under the paint.
- Blistering: Raised pockets caused by â˘trapped moisture, solvent entrapmentor outgassing during cure.

Compatibility with Whirlpool Appliance Models and Replacementâ Considerations
the 350930 Whirlpool White Spray Paint is used primarily as a â¤cosmetic touch-up material for visible exterior components on Whirlpool âappliances,such as door panels,control bezels,and trim pieces. Technically,this spray âpaint is formulatedâ for adhesion to painted or primed metal and certain âhard plastics; tho,OEM finishes and color formulations vary by model year and production batch,so absolute â˘color match is not guaranteed. Performance factors to evaluate for compatibility include substrate type (steel, aluminized steel, âŁABS,â polypropylene), surface energy (which affectsâ wetting and adhesion)and âtheâ paint’s chemical and abrasion âresistanceâ relative to⤠typical applianceâ service conditions (household detergents, humidityand⢠mechanicalâ wear). Such as, a refrigeratorâ door with âintact powder coat can accept â˘localized spray touch-up after proper scuffing and priming, while â¤a plastic control bezel may require an adhesion promoter or a paint âŁspecifically qualified for that polymer family.
When deciding âbetween â˘refinishing with spray paint and replacing a part, consider âŁstructural integrity, thermal exposureand âŁserviceability. ⣠Do not use the spray paint on surfaces exposed to high continuous temperatures (heat strips, burnersor dryer heating elements), as standard appliance spray⣠paints âŁare not rated for sustained high-temperature environments; use a high-temperature coating or replace the component instead. Practical replacement considerations include verifying the appliance model and â¤part number against Whirlpool parts diagrams, testing the paint on aâ non-visible area to assess color and⤠adhesionand performing proper surface preparation: degreasing, abrasive scuffing, appropriate primer selectionand following recommended cure times.⣠Typical preparation checklist includes:
- Verify model/part number and assess whether damage is purely cosmetic.
- Clean and degrease the surface; remove corrosion or loose coating.
- Scuff with appropriate media, apply primer suited to the substrate, then âtest a small area.
- Allow full cure before reassemblingâ and expose only non-high-temperature areas to painted surfaces.

Q&A
What is 350930 Whirlpool White Spray Paint⤠and âwhat isâ it used for?
350930 is a Whirlpool-branded aerosol touch-up paint formulated to restore or conceal chips, scratches and minor cosmetic damage on âŁthe painted or enamelledâ exterior âsurfaces of Whirlpool â˘appliances. It’s intended for small repairs rather than refinishing an entire appliance.
Will⤠this spray paint exactly match my â˘appliance’s⣠original white color?
The product is formulated to match Whirlpool’s factory white,but exact matchâ can vary with age,fading and finish differences between models. For the âbest result,test the color in an inconspicuous area and allow it to dry before judging the match. Older appliances frequently enough require blending or⢠replacement parts forâ a perfect match.
Which surfaces can I use this paint on (metal, porcelain/enamel, âplastic)?
It is suitable for painted and enamelled metal surfaces commonly foundâ on refrigerators, dishwashers and ranges. â˘Use caution on porcelain-enamel: the â˘paint can adhere but may chip over time. For plastics, use only with a plastic adhesion primer and test first, since not⣠all plastics âaccept âconventional appliance spray paints.
How should I prepare the surface beforeâ applying the spray paint?
Clean the area thoroughly to remove âŁgrease,dirt and loose particles (use mild detergent or isopropyl âalcohol). Lightly sand rough edges and⢠feather the surrounding paint to âcreate a smooth transition.Remove rust⣠and apply a metalâ primer to bare metal. Mask off adjacent areas to avoid overspray.
What is the recommended application â¤technique (distance, number of coats, drying between coats)?
Shake the can well before use.⢠Spray in even, light passes from about â6-8 inches⤠(15-20 cm) away, keeping the canâ moving to avoid runs. Apply multiple thin coats rather than â¤one heavy coat; typically 2-3 light coats provide good coverage.â Allow âthe flash/dry time indicated on the can⣠between coats (frequently enough several minutes). Avoid heavy wet coats to prevent sagging.
How long does the paint take to dry and fully cure?
Drying times depend on temperature and âhumidity.â The paint will often be⢠dry to the touch within minutes to an hour; you can normally recoat after the short flash â¤time noted⤠on the can.Full hard cure typically takes 24-72⢠hours. Avoid heavy⣠cleaning, abrasion or reattaching trim until the paint has fully cured.
Is⢠it safe âto use insideâ a refrigerator or on surfaces that contact âfood?
This spray paint⢠is intended â¤for exterior cosmetic repairs and is not recommended for surfacesâ that comeâ into direct âŁcontact with âfood.If âused near food storage âŁareas, ensure the areaâ is well cured and ventilated and avoid spraying inside compartments where foodâ will be placed.â consult Whirlpool guidance for â˘interior repairs.
What safety â˘and storage precautions should I follow when using⣠this aerosol paint?
Use in a well-ventilated area and wear appropriate⤠PPE (respirator â˘rated for solvents, gloves, eye protection). Keep away from heat, sparks and open flame – â¤aerosol propellants are flammable. Store upright in a cool, dry place away from direct sunlight and extreme temperatures. Dispose of âŁempty â¤or partially full cans according to local hazardous-waste regulations.
